Purdy: "If I can play this game, I want to play" vs. Rams

The San Francisco 49ers face a pivotal decision as quarterback Brock Purdy deals with toe soreness ahead of their Thursday night matchup against the Los Angeles Rams.

Why it matters: The outcome of this game could significantly impact the NFC West standings, where both teams currently hold a 3-1 record.

  • A victory would solidify the 49ers' position at the top of the division, while a loss could create a more competitive landscape moving forward.
  • The 49ers have already proven to be a formidable force in the league with their strong start, highlighted by their 2-0 record within the division.

What’s new: Head coach Kyle Shanahan confirmed that Purdy's status remains uncertain, creating tension leading up to the game.

  • If Purdy is unable to play, backup Mac Jones will step into the starting role, having led his team to victories earlier this season against the New Orleans Saints and Arizona Cardinals.
  • Jones, who is no longer limited by a knee injury, has expressed readiness for this potential opportunity: "That's your job as a backup... I definitely approach it that way."

Yes, but: Purdy's ability to play hinges not only on pain management but also on his capacity to perform effectively given his current physical condition.

  • Shanahan emphasized the importance of ensuring that Purdy can protect himself adequately during the game: "It'll come down to do we feel he could play and to 100 percent of his ability."
  • This caution signals the coaching staff's commitment to player safety, especially considering Purdy's recent recovery from earlier injuries that kept him sidelined.

What to watch: The 49ers' skill position group is notably depleted, which could affect offensive efficiency if Purdy is unable to take the field.

  • Key players like wide receiver Brandon Aiyuk (knee) and tight end George Kittle (hamstring) are already ruled out, further complicating the team's game plan.
  • With Jauan Jennings and Ricky Pearsall also hampered by injury, the 49ers may need to rely heavily on their remaining healthy talent, including emerging stars and role players.
